Consider a completely randomized design involving four treatments: A, B, C, and D. Select a correct multiple regression equation that can be used to analyze these data. Define all variables. I. E(y) = Bo + B1 21 22 23 24, where 21 = 1 if treatment A, 21 = 0, otherwise; x2 = 1 if treatment B, 32 = 0, otherwise; 23 = 1 if treatment C, 33 = 0, otherwise; 24 = 1 if treatment D, 24 = 0, otherwise. II. E(y) = Bo + B121 + B222 + B323 + B4204, where 21 = 1 if treatment A, 21 = 0, otherwise; 22 = 1 if treatment B, 22 = 0, otherwise; 23 = 1 if treatment C, 13 = 0, otherwise; 24 = 1 if treatment D, 24 = 0, otherwise. III. E(y) = Bo + B121 + B222 + B323, where 21 = 1 if treatment B, 21 = 0, otherwise; 22 = 1 if treatment C, 22 = 0, otherwise; 23 = 1 if treatment D, 13 = 0, otherwise. Select your answer

Answers

Option III "E(y) = B₀ + B₁x₁ + B₂x₂ + B₃x₃, where x₁ = 1 if treatment B, x₁ = 0, otherwise; x₂ = 1 if treatment C, x₂ = 0, otherwise; x₃ = 1 if treatment D, x₃ = 0, otherwise." is a correct multiple regression equation that can be used to analyze these data. So the option III is correct.

Randomized design involving four treatments: A, B, C, and D.

So total number of treatments = 4(A, B, C, D)

So the number of dummy variable is required = 4 - 1

The number of dummy variable is required = 3

The three variables would be x₁ x₂ and x₃ and the fourth treatment scenario would be represented if all three were zero.

So the option III is correct because this is a correct multiple regression equation because it contains all the necessary components to define a linear regression model.

Specifically, it contains a dependent variable (y), a constant (B₀), and three independent variables (x₁, x₂, x₃). Additionally, each of the independent variables is either assigned a value of 1 or 0 depending on the treatment, which is how a linear regression model is typically constructed.

There is a bag filled with 3 blue, 4 red and 5 green marbles.
A marble is taken at random from the bag, the colour is noted and then it is replaced.
Another marble is taken at random.
What is the probability of exactly 1 red?

Answers

Answer:

22.22%

Step-by-step explanation:

If it is exactly a red, it means that it is removed on the first or second attempt, but only once, in this case it does not matter if it is on the first or second attempt because the marble is returned to the bag.

So suppose that on the first attempt red is drawn, the probability would be:

4 / (3 + 4 + 5) = 4/12 = 1/3

Now, on the second attempt, it is not to draw a red, it must be green or blue, so it would be:

(5 + 3) / (3 + 4 + 5) = 8/12 = 2/3

The final probability then is:

1/3 * 2/3 = 0.2222

that is, the probability is 22.22%

Annette has 3 hours to spend training for an upcoming race. She completes her training by running full speed the distance of the race and walking back the same distance to cool down. If she runs at a speed of 9mph and walks back at a speed of 3mph , how long should she plan to spend walking back?

Answers

Answer:

Annette should plan to spend 2.25 hours walking back.

Step-by-step explanation:

To solve this problem, we can use the formula:

Time = Distance / Speed

Let's assume the distance of the race is D miles.

Annette spends her time running the distance of the race, which takes:

Time running = D / 9 hours

She then walks back the same distance, which we need to find the time for:

Time walking = D / 3 hours

Since Annette has a total of 3 hours for her training, the sum of the running time and walking time should equal 3 hours:

D / 9 + D / 3 = 3

To simplify the equation, we can multiply all terms by 9 to eliminate the denominators:

D + 3D = 27

Combining like terms:

4D = 27

Dividing both sides of the equation by 4:

D = 6.75

So, the distance of the race is 6.75 miles.

To find the time Annette should spend walking back, we substitute the distance into the time-walking formula:

Time walking = D / 3 = 6.75 / 3 = 2.25 hours

Therefore, Annette should plan to spend 2.25 hours walking back.
